L&W Supply Acquires Holmes Drywall Supply

Acquisition Expands Distributor’s Presence in Kansas City and Topeka Markets

CHICAGO – Jan. 3, 2022 – L&W Supply Corporation, a leading distributor of top-quality building materials and specialty products in the United States, announced today that it has acquired the assets of Holmes Drywall Supply with locations in Kansas City, Missouri, Lee’s Summit, Missouri and Topeka, Kansas. By acquiring Holmes, L&W Supply will increase its team of experienced associates and strengthen its presence in eastern Kansas. With the acquisition, L&W Supply now has three locations in the Kansas City and Topeka markets.

Founded as a family business in 1967, Holmes Drywall Supply is one of the area’s largest distributors of drywall, metal studs, insulation and acoustical ceiling products serving commercial and residential contractors. The Holmes associates will continue to work at the locations, ensuring customers receive seamless access to the products and expertise they need to run their businesses.

“This acquisition allows L&W Supply to enhance our service to commercial customers and build deeper relationships with contractors and residential builders in the Kansas City and Topeka areas,” said Curt Jenkins, vice president of L&W Supply’s Central Region. “We are excited to welcome the Holmes associates to the L&W Supply family. Their commitment to customers over the past 54 years has made them a leader in the market.”
